Best cities for a development officer

The best cities for development officers are Newark, NJ, Oakland, CA, and Saint Paul, MN, based on factors like average salary and job availability per capita. Jobs and pay for development officers vary across the country, but we've determined the ten best cities for development officers in the U.S.

Whether you're starting your career as a development officer or considering a move, this list of the best cities for development officers to live in will help you decide. These aren't just the best-paying cities for development officers. We also consider how easy it is to find work as a development officer. While the absolute best city for development officers is Newark, NJ, there are plenty of other great places to consider.
